If using the method of completing the square to solve the quadratic equation, which number would have to be added to “complete the square”?

X^2+7x-4=0

Respuesta :

Problem

[tex]x^2\text{ + 7x - 4 = 0}[/tex]

Step 1:

a = 1 b = 7 and c = -4

Step 2:

The number that you will add to complete the square is square of half of the coefficient of x.

[tex]\begin{gathered} \text{The number that must be added to complete the square} \\ =\text{ }(\frac{7}{2})^2 \\ =\text{ }\frac{49}{4} \end{gathered}[/tex]

The number that you will add to complete the square = 49/4

To solve the equation complete, first move the constant value to the right hand side.

[tex]x^2\text{ + 7x = 4}[/tex]

Next, add 49/4 to both sides.
